Theodoros Teknos, MD

Theodoros Teknos, MD

President and Scientific Director University Hospitals Seidman Cancer Center

Theodoros (Ted) N. Teknos, MD, is president and scientific director of University Hospitals Seidman Cancer Center at University Hospitals Cleveland Medical Center and deputy director of the Case Comprehensive Cancer Center.

He holds the Jane and Lee Seidman Chair in Cancer Innovation and is board certified in otolaryngology-head and neck surgery. As president and scientific director, Dr. Teknos leads strategic, business, and marketing planning for UH Seidman and oversees all inpatient and ambulatory cancer care delivered across the University Hospitals system.

He also directs the center’s academic components and clinical trials unit and its involvement in the Case Comprehensive Cancer Center. A renowned clinician and academic authority in head and neck cancers, Dr. Teknos maintains an active surgical practice along with clinical trials and research. He has been published in more than 200 peer-reviewed journals and is a frequent presenter at major scientific meetings, and he is active in professional societies including the American Society of Clinical Oncology, the American Association for Cancer Research, and the American College of Surgeons.

Dr. Teknos joined University Hospitals in 2017 from The Ohio State University Wexner Medical Center, where he served as professor and chair of the Department of Otolaryngology-Head and Neck Surgery.

Earlier, he was chief of the head and neck oncology division in the Department of Otolaryngology at the University of Michigan Health System.

He earned his medical degree from Harvard Medical School, completed his otolaryngology residency in the Massachusetts Eye and Ear Infirmary/Harvard combined program, and completed a fellowship in head and neck oncology, skull base, and microvascular reconstruction at Vanderbilt University Medical Center.
